#267890 - RGB(38, 120, 144) - Jelly Bean Color FAQ

What is the color code for Jelly Bean?

Hex color code for Jelly Bean color is #267890. RGB color code for jelly bean color is rgb(38, 120, 144).

What is the RGB value of #267890?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#267890 is rgb(38, 120, 144).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'38' indicates the intensity of the red component, '120' represents the green component's intensity, and '144'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#267890.

What does RGB 38,120,144 mean?

The RGB color 38, 120, 144 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 336699.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Jelly Bean.
